Abstract |
Nucleic acids extracted from microbial biomass were hybridized with probes representing four mer operons, to detect genes encoding adaptation to Hg2+. An enrichment in sequences similar to the mer genes of transposon 501 occurred during adaptation in a freshwater community. In an estuarine community, all four mer genes were only slightly enriched, suggesting that additional, yet uncharacterized, mer genes encodeded adaptation to HG2+. |
